Charlie Hall is taking a deep dive into the Green Industry Economic Climate and Forecast for 2023.
"The price of labor continues to go up, but the rate that it’s rising is decreasing. That’s because the number of available jobs is slowly starting to decline."

@ClimateLLC_ag Scott Speck on the results of tech in ag. US corn yields were flat for decades but the adoption of tech from hybrid corn to synthetic fertilizer, GM crops, and precision ag drove a huge wave of growth. The next driver will be digital ag. #TechHubLIVE
